What priority includes lanes for aircraft crash fire equipment?

Explanation:
Unobstructed access for aircraft rescue and firefighting (ARFF) equipment is critical in an incident. Because every second counts, the lanes that allow ARFF vehicles to reach the aircraft quickly must be kept clear at all times. These designated lanes provide a reliable path from access roads to the incident site, enabling pumps, foam, and personnel to arrive without delay. Keeping these routes free of parked aircraft, ground support equipment, or other obstructions directly enhances safety and the effectiveness of the response, which is why this item is treated as the top priority on the airfield.

Exam Format

Understanding the exam format is crucial for effective preparation. The Airfield Management Block 1 Exam typically consists of multiple-choice questions designed to test your knowledge on various aspects of airfield operations. Here’s what to expect:

  • Number of Questions: The exam usually contains between 50 to 80 questions.
  • Question Format: Each question offers four possible answers. Your task is to select the most accurate one.
  • Time Allotted: Participants are generally given between 1.5 to 2 hours to complete the test, allowing ample time to ponder each question.
  • Pass Mark: A score of typically 70% or above is required to pass the exam, which equates to correctly answering approximately 35 to 56 questions depending on the total number.
